#9b2651 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9b2651 is composed of 60.8% red, 14.9%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.5% magenta, 47.7%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 337.9 degrees, a saturation of 60.6% and a lightness of 37.8%. #9b2651 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4ca2 with #370000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#9b2651

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0307 is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b2651

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#675a5f is the less saturated color, while #c00147 is the most saturated one.
